The Orioles today announced that they have selected the contract of outfielder Chris Dickerson from Triple-A Norfolk. To make room for him on the 40-man roster, infielder Alex Liddi has been designated for assignment.
Dickerson, 31, batted .245/.274/.412 in 46 games with the Orioles earlier this season.
